본문 바로가기

Infrastructure/Cloud Computing

(27)
[Well-Architected] Cost Optimization Pillar Cost Optimization Pillar 이번 장에서는 Well-Architected Framework의 비용 최적화 원칙(Cost Optimization Pillar)에 대해서 알아본다. 비용 최적화 원칙 “비용 최적화 원칙”은 가장 낮은 가격으로 비즈니스 성과를 달성하는 능력에 대한 모든 것이며 중점 영역은 아래와 같다. 클라우드 재무 관리: 비용 및 사용량을 최적화하여 비즈니스 가치와 재정 안정성 실현 지출 인식을 통해 비용이 지출되고 있는 곳을 제어 및 이해 예약 인스턴스 및 스팟 등의 비용 효율적인 리소스 유형 선택 수요 관리 및 Auto Scaling, 캐싱 또는 대기열과 같은 리소스 제공 시간이 지나면서 새로운 서비스 또는 기능을 이용해 최적화 설계 원칙 기존 환경에서의 비용 최적화 원칙..
[Well-Architected] Performance Efficiency Pillar Performance Efficiency Pillar 이번 장에서는 Well-Architected Framework의 성능 효율성 원칙(Performance Efficiency Pillar)에 대해서 알아본다. 성능 효율성 원칙 성능 효율성 원칙은 IT 리소스를 효율적으로 사용할 수 있는 능력을 중심으로 하며, 중점 영역은 아래와 같다. 컴퓨팅 스토리지 데이터베이스 네트워킹에 적합한 리소스 유형 AWS가 새로운 리소스 유형 및 기능을 통해 혁신을 계속함에 따라 선택사항을 검토해야 한다. 모니터링 및 아키텍처 절충을 통해 리소스가 어떻게 수행되고 있는지 파악하여 성능 효율성을 극대화할 수 있다. 성능 효율성 설계 원칙 기존 환경에서의 성능 효율성 성능 효율성에 대해 생각할 때 기존 환경에서 가졌던 제약 조..
[Well-Architected] Reliability Pillar Reliability Pillar 이번 장에서는 Well-Architected Framework의 안정성 원칙(Reliability Pillar)에 대해서 알아본다. 안정성 원칙 안정성은 워크로드가 의도한 기능을 원하는 시점에 올바르고 일관되게 수행할 수 있는 능력이다. 전체 수명 주기 동안 워크로드를 작동 및 테스트하는 기능이 포함되며, 안정성을 달성하기 위해 복원력에 중점을 둔다. 복원력이란 인프라 또는 서비스 중단으로부터 복구하고, 수요에 맞춰 컴퓨팅 리소스를 동적으로 확보하고, 구성 오류나 일시적 네트워크 문제와 같은 중단 사태를 완화할 수 있는 워크로드의 기능이다. 안정성 원칙은 아래 영역에서 장애로부터 복구하고 요구를 충족할 수 있는 기능에 중점을 둔다. 설정 및 교차 프로젝트 요구 사항을 포..
[Well-Architected] Security Pillar Security Pillar 이번 장에서는 Well-Architected Framework의 보안(Security)에 대해서 알아본다. 보안 보안 원칙은 정보 및 시스템을 보호하는 능력에 중점을 두며, 아래와 같은 5가지 핵심 영역이 있다. 자격 증명 및 액세스 관리를 통해 누가 무엇을 할 수 있는지 제어한다. 탐지 제어를 통해 보안 이벤트를 탐지한다. 인프라 보호를 통해 시스템을 보호한다. 데이터의 기밀성 및 무결성을 유지한다. 보안 이벤트에 대한 대응을 한다. 보안 설계 원칙 보안 설계 원칙을 도입하면 클라우드 네이티브 아키텍처를 구축하여 운영할 수 있다. 보안을 모든 계층에 적용하여 사용량과 변동 사항을 추적하기 때문에 코드를 트리거하여 이벤트 또는 이벤트 조합에 대응할 수 있다. 세분화된 액세스 ..
[Well-Architected] Operational Excellence Pillar Operational Excellence Pillar 이번 장에서는 Well-Architected Framework의 운영 우수성(Operational Excellence Pillar)에 대해서 알아본다. 운영 우수성 원칙 비즈니스 가치를 실현하고 지원 프로세스 및 절차를 지속적으로 개선하기 위해 시스템을 실행 및 모니터링하는 능력이다. 운영 우수성 원칙에서의 중점 영역은 아래와 같다. 조직: 고객은 조직의 우선 순위, 조직 구조 및 팀 구성원이 비즈니스 성과를 지원할 수 있도록 조직이 팀 구성원을 지원하는 방법을 이해해야 한다. 준비: 고객은 운영 아키텍처를 설계해야 한다. 아키텍처를 실제로 구현하거나 대폭적으로 변경해야 할 시점에 정보에 근거한 의사 결정을 하려면 워크로드와 팀의 준비 상태를 살펴야 ..
[Well-Architected] Basics Basics 이번 장에서는 Well-Architected Framework란 무엇인지에 대해서 알아본다. Well-Architected의 목적 정보에 근거한 의사 결정을 한다. 클라우드 네이티브 방식으로 생각한다. 잠재적인 영향을 파악한다. 고객이 소홀이 할 때가 많은 기본 영역을 고려하고 있는지 확인한다. Well-Architected Framework 아키텍처 모범 사례에 대한 인식을 개선한다. 소홀히 하기 쉬운 기본 영역을 다룬다. 워크로드 아키텍처를 평가하는 일관된 접근 방식을 제공한다. Well-Architected 프레임워크의 3대 요소는 아래와 같다. 질문 원칙 설계 원칙 워크로드: 비즈니스 또는 운영 가치를 제공하는 AWS에서 실행되는 상호관련된 애플리케이션, 인프라, 정책, 거버넌스 및 ..
[Cloud Computing] 다중 플랫폼 사용에 대한 고찰 정말 많은 종류의 클라우드 컴퓨팅 플랫폼이 존재한다. 고찰의 시작 얼마전 네이버클라우드에 재직 중인 전 회사 동료와 식사를 하게 되었고 아래와 같은 대화를 나누게 되었다. 필자: 네이버클라우드(이하 네클) 사용하다가 나중에 글로벌 시장에 진출하면 어떻게 해. 네이버클라우드 리전 별로 없잖아. 지인: AWS에 비해 없는거지 별로 없진 않아. 필자: 네클 사용하다가 리전없는 지역으로 서비스 확장하면 AWS랑 네클 연동해야하는데 연동하는 건 개발자들의 숙제아니야? CDN도 다른 서비스랑 연동해야할텐데... 지인: 그건 그렇지. 근데 AWS라고 모든 곳에 IDC가 있는 것도 아니고 그런거 해결하는게 진짜 개발자 아니야??? 고찰 과정 하이엔드 개발자들은 어떤 생각을 하는지 궁금해하는 일반 개발자의 개인적인 의견..
[AWS] Reserved Instance 예약 인스턴스 (Reserved Instance, 이하 RI) RI란 EC2 인스턴스에 대한 용량을 예약하여 할인된 비용으로 EC2 인스턴스를 사용할 수 있는 서비스를 얘기한다. RI 유형 RI에는 총 세가지 유형이 있다. 표준 RI: 가장 큰 할인 혜택(온디맨드 대비 최대 72%)을 제공하며 RI의 속성을 변경할 수 없으며 사용량이 꾸준한 경우에 가장 적합하다. 컨버터블 RI: 할인 혜택(온디맨드 대비 최대 54%)을 제공하며 RI의 속성을 변경할 수 있으며 사용량이 꾸준한 경우에 적합하다. 예정된 RI: 예약한 시간 범위 내에서 인스턴스를 시작할 수 있다. 표준 & 컨버터블 RI는 꾸준한 사용량에 적합하며 예정된 RI는 특정 시점에만 인스턴스가 필요한 경우에 적합하다. 예약 인스턴스의 특징 지금부터 ..